The Pre-Anesthesia Assistant Nurse Manager supports the Nurse Manager in the planning, organization, and implementation of unit-based services to ensure high-quality patient care and operational excellence within the pre-anesthesia setting. This role assists with fiscal management, performance improvement initiatives, and maintaining compliance with all applicable policies, procedures, and regulatory requirements. The Pre-Anesthesia Assistant Nurse Manager actively participates in personnel processes, including staff engagement, effective communication, and shared decision-making, while supporting timely problem-solving and change management efforts. Strong collaboration with interdisciplinary departments is essential to this role. Serving as key bench strength for the Nurse Manager, the Pre-Anesthesia Assistant Nurse Manager helps ensure continuity of leadership and fosters a positive, accountable, and patient-centered care environment.
